Triggers enable your agents to run automatically based on schedules, webhooks, or external events. Build powerful automation workflows without manual intervention.
Overview
Kortix supports three types of triggers:
Schedule : Run agents on a recurring schedule (cron-based)
Webhook : Trigger agents via HTTP requests
Event : React to external service events (via integrations)

Run agents on a regular schedule using cron expressions. Use Cases
Daily reports and summaries
Periodic data synchronization
Scheduled monitoring and alerts
Regular backups and maintenance
Configuration {
"provider_id" : "schedule" ,
"name" : "Daily Sales Report" ,
"config" : {
"cron" : "0 9 * * *" ,
"timezone" : "America/New_York" ,
"prompt" : "Generate a sales report for yesterday"
}
}
Common Cron Patterns Pattern Description 0 9 * * *Every day at 9:00 AM 0 */6 * * *Every 6 hours 0 9 * * 1Every Monday at 9:00 AM 0 0 1 * *First day of every month */15 * * * *Every 15 minutes
Trigger agents via HTTP POST requests. Use Cases
Integrate with external systems
Process form submissions
Handle payment notifications
Respond to third-party events
Configuration {
"provider_id" : "webhook" ,
"name" : "New Customer Webhook" ,
"config" : {
"prompt_template" : "Process new customer: {{customer_name}} ({{customer_email}})"
}
}
Webhook URL Format https://api.kortix.com/triggers/webhook/{trigger_id}
Triggering via HTTP curl -X POST https://api.kortix.com/triggers/webhook/{trigger_id} \
-H "Content-Type: application/json" \
-d '{
"customer_name": "John Doe",
"customer_email": "john@example.com",
"plan": "pro"
}'
Webhook payloads are available to the agent via template variables: {{variable_name}}
React to events from integrated services (Gmail, Slack, etc.). Use Cases
Process incoming emails
Respond to Slack mentions
Handle GitHub pull requests
React to calendar events
Configuration (Composio Integration){
"provider_id" : "composio" ,
"name" : "New Gmail Email" ,
"config" : {
"trigger_slug" : "GMAIL_NEW_EMAIL" ,
"profile_id" : "profile-123" ,
"prompt_template" : "New email from {{sender}}: {{subject}}"
}
}
Available Event Sources
Gmail (new emails, labels)
Slack (messages, mentions)
GitHub (PRs, issues, commits)
Calendar (new events, reminders)
Linear (issues, updates)
And more via Composio integration

Trigger Execution
How Triggers Work
Event Detection
The trigger provider detects an event:
Schedule: Cron time matches
Webhook: HTTP request received
Event: External service sends notification
Prompt Generation
The trigger’s prompt template is populated with event data: prompt_template = "New email from {{ sender }} : {{ subject }} "
event_data = { "sender" : "john@example.com" , "subject" : "Help needed" }
# Result: "New email from john@example.com: Help needed"
Agent Execution
A new agent run is started with the generated prompt.
Result Logging
Execution results are logged for monitoring and debugging.
Template Variables
Access event data in your prompts using {{variable}} syntax:
Webhook Data
{
"customer_name" : "John Doe" ,
"order_id" : "12345" ,
"amount" : 99.99
}
Prompt Template
New order from {{customer_name}}:
- Order ID: {{order_id}}
- Amount: ${{amount}}
Please process and send confirmation.
Generated Prompt
New order from John Doe:
- Order ID: 12345
- Amount: $99.99
Please process and send confirmation.

Best Practices
Schedule Optimization
Avoid overlapping schedules for the same agent
Consider timezone differences for distributed teams
Use appropriate intervals (avoid excessive frequency)
Add buffer time for long-running tasks
Webhook Security
Validate webhook payloads in your application
Use HTTPS for webhook endpoints
Consider adding authentication headers
Monitor for unusual webhook activity
Error Handling
Include error handling in agent prompts
Monitor trigger execution logs
Set up alerts for failed triggers
Test triggers thoroughly before production use
Prompt Design
Keep prompts clear and actionable
Include all necessary context
Use structured formats for consistency
Test with various input scenarios
